Return to Bone: Obsidia accumulates Bone Energy by dealing damage to enemies, minions, or structures. Once her energy bar is full, she gains a Bone Shard. When she uses a basic attack, all collected bone shards are unleashed, dealing additional physical damage to the target. Crit
A critical build is important for Obsidia because her Bone Shards can deal critical damage, making items that boost critical chance and damage highly effective. This setup maximizes her damage output, especially in the mid to late game, allowing her to quickly eliminate enemies

Bone Shard Generation: Obsidia's passive, "Return to Bone," relies on her dealing damage to generate Bone Energy and then Bone Shards. A higher attack speed means she can deal damage more frequently, thus generating and unleashing her bone shards much faster. This directly translates to significantly increased damage output.

Best With Angela
While attached, Angela can cast her skills without consuming mana. This allows her to spam Love Waves and Puppet-on-a-String, providing continuous healing, slowing, and immobilization to support Obsidia
